Male and female dropouts and graduates (N = 248) from a traditional drug-free therapeutic community were followed 2 years after treatment. A 4-hr face-to-face interview traced the social adjustment one year pre-, through all years posttreatment. Results showed that (a) success (no crime and no opioid and/or no use of nonopioid primary drug) was maintained through 2 years of follow-up by 34% of the dropouts and 68% of the graduates; (b) success rates were highest among opioid abusers and the lowest among primary alcohol abusers; (c) among the latter, however, abstinence rates were significantly increased and daily use of alcohol significantly decreased as did criminal involvement; (d) among the opioid abstinent group, alcohol use increased posttreatment but heavy drinking was not prominent indicating no significant shift in substance dependency. Overall, the therapeutic community appears most effective for opioid abusers but has a clear impact on a considerable number of those primarily involved with alcohol and other substance use.  相似文献

Olfactory stimulation evokes a column of activity within the olfactory bulb extending from the glomerular layer to the granule cell layer that can be visualized with 2-deoxyglucose autoradiography, optical imaging, Fos protein immunohistochemistry and c-fos mRNA in situ hybridization. The Fos response to odors is typified by the activity of relatively few juxtaglomerular cells, which often occur in foci, and a large number of granule cells extending through much of the bulb. In this study, we characterized the granule cell response to an odor for which young rats had acquired a preference. Fos-like immunoreactive granule cells were quantified by image analysis, and densely stained cells were counted in a region previously shown to be responsive to peppermint odor. We found that odor-trained pups have about half the number of Fos-immunopositive superficial granule cells which respond to a learned odor than do control pups. We then determined whether there was a correlation between the juxtaglomerular cell response and the response of the superficial granule cells deep to those glomerular layer cells. We found a positive correlation between the number of juxtaglomerular cells and the number of granule cells demonstrating Fos immunoreactivity in both control and trained pups, a relationship that changed with early olfactory training.  相似文献

MRI studies of first-pass contrast enhancement with polylysine-Gd-DTPA and myocardial tagging using spatial modulation of magnetization (SPAMM) were performed to assess the feasibility of a combined regional myocardial blood flow and 2D deformation exam. Instrumented closed-chest dogs were imaged at a baseline control state (Cntl) followed by two interventions: moderate coronary stenosis (St) achieved by partial occlusion of the left anterior descending (LAD) and moderate coronary stenosis with dobutamine loading (StD). Hypoperfusion of the anterior region (ANT) of the myocardium (LAD distribution) relative to the posterior wall (POS) based on the upslope of the signal intensity time curve from the contrast-enhanced MR images was demonstrated only with dobutamine loading (ANT:POS Cntl=1.077 ± 0.15 versus ANT:POS StD=0.477 ± 0.11, P<0.03) and was confirmed with radio-labeled microspheres measurements (ANT:POS Cntl=1.18 ± 0.2 ml/min/g versus ANT:POS StD=0.44 ± 0.1 ml/min/g; P<0.002). Significant changes in regional myocardial shortening were only seen in the StD state (P<0.02); the anterior region showed impaired myocardial shortening with dobutamine loading (P=NS), whereas the nonaffected POS region showed a marked increase in shortening when compared with Cntl (Cntl=0.964 ± 0.02 versus StD=0.884 ± 0.03; P<0.001). These results demonstrate that an integrated quantitative assessment of regional myocardial function and semiquantitative assessment of myocardial blood flow can be performed noninvasively with ultrafast MRI.  相似文献

In the past two decades, there has been a gradual trend to regionalization of perinatal care, categorization of hospitals and transport services for neonatal health care. The literature alludes to both beneficial and deleterious effects of neonatal transport (T) but no controls such as a matched nontransport (NT) population have been utilized to date.The major goal of this study was to evaluate the effect of neonatal transport from Level I and II high risk 2500 gm. neonates (born in NYC in one calendar year, 1979) compared to a cohort nontransported population matched for hospital of birth, weight, race, sex and risk. All transported 2500 gm. from Level I and II (n=328) were studied and a stratified random sample of the nontransported (NT) infants 2500 gm. from these same hospitals (n=2042) was used for comparison. The principle outcome variable was survival. The major conclusion of this study is that in Level I and II hospitals the transport group had a significantly increased survival in infants who were sick (Apgar <6) compared to cohorted nontransported controls. Labelled proteins conveyed by fast axonal transport into the sensory axons of frog sciatic nerve following axotomy have been studied by 2D gel electrophoresis. Previous work showed that in frogs acclimatized to 25 °C a cell body reaction occurs, along with regeneration of axons to their targets. In contrast, frogs acclimatized to 15 °C showed no cell body reaction and though regeneration began, it stalled after approximately 35 days. We found that axotomy at 25 °C was followed by an increase in transport of specific labelled proteins corresponding to growth-associated proteins (GAPs) identified in other regenerating systems. Surprisingly, axotomy at 15 °C also induced a similar increase, though with a slower onset, so that the highest levels of expression of GAPs occurred during the time when the axons had stalled. We conclude that sensory neurons in 15 °C frogs do detect that their axons have been injured, as shown by their ability to increase GAP synthesis. Slow and limited axonal growth is possible during a period when GAP synthesis is low compared to levels in rapidly regenerating nerves, but even when the ability to produce GAPs increases, this alone is not sufficient to sustain regeneration in the absence of other components of the cell body reaction to injury.  相似文献
